Sony Delays Columbia Classics Vol 2, Underworld 5-Film Collection, and Guns of Navarone 4K Ultra HD Blu-rays

Given how difficult it's become lately to find new releases in stores or online retailers to meet their pre-orders, it's no surprise that Sony is delaying Columbia Classics Vol 2Underworld 5-Film Collection, and The Guns of Navarone

If you've gone out to your local big-box store and couldn't find either Paramount's Star Trek: 4-Movie Collection or Universal's release of John Carpenter's The Thing or had your online pre-order delayed - we're seeing the side effects of virtually every major studio and boutique label dropping an array of high-demand product all at the same time. The supply chain simply can't keep up with that demand and it also puts a crunch on QC. As such - it looks like Sony is flipping up their release schedule a little to hopefully accommodate for pre-orders and brick and mortar shop stock. So if you were planning to get these titles, you have some schedule readjustments to make. 

First up - Columbia Classics Vol 2 is getting another delay, this time to October 12th.  

Columbia Classics Vol 2 4K Ultra HD Blu-ray 

Next up, while not a HUGE one on most folks' wishlist, Underworld 5-Film Collection is pushed to October 26th. 

Underworld 5-Film Collection 4K UHD 


And last, The Guns of Navarone apparently will now drop on November 12th - but that is a Friday and not the standard Tuesday release day, so I don't expect that day to stick either. 

The Guns of Navarone 4K UHD Bluray 

So far, that's the only big change in Sony's release slate, but of course that could change. We've already seen a number of titles get moved around from all of the studios ahead of the Holiday shopping season and we're likely to see some more movement - especially as more new titles are announced. If anything changes again for either of these three titles, we'll update things and keep you all posted.

      Physical media connoisseurs have long waited for that beautiful day when (now) Disney/Fox would announce that James Cameron's underwater sci-fi classic The Abyss would one day arrive on disc in a condition far better than the SD letterboxed release of so long ago. Practically every time a cult classic or another title gets announced for the format someone inevitably asks the now redundant question "When are they going to put out The Abyss and True Lies?" We're also eagerly awaiting True Lies - and no that Spanish disc sourced from an old broadcast HD master doesn't count. While we're at it let's toss on Kathryn Bigalow's Strange Days too. 

      The excuses for why either The Abyss or True Lies haven't been released get thinner and thinner every year. 2019 was the perfect time for those films to arrive. The Abyss turned 30 and True Lies turned 25 - major milestone anniversaries that would be ripe pickings for collectors to gobble up these films. Alas, we wait. And wait. The latest rumor is maybe possibly in 2022 timed to help hype Cameron's Avatar 2... but then maybe the Abyss never existed at all and we're all sharing a collective fever dream, like in Prince of Darkness.

      Ease Your Pain - Watch The Abyss In HD On Amazon Prime

      Previously, whenever this film would crop up on streaming services or if you were lucky and managed to redeem the Disc-To-Digital option on VUDU, it was sourced from the ancient letterboxed master used for DVD - and then it wasn't even anamorphic and would often appear squeezed. This current streaming master is in much better shape free of any speckling, grit, or other age-related issues. It also has different color timing than the old DVD and LaserDisc favoring that icy Cameron Blue tint instead of the brighter purplish tone folks may remember. 

      In the video below you can see the differences. We did have to adjust the brightness of the HD Streaming, the recorder we used darkened it quite a bit. Also, this video is rougher than our usual full rez spit and polished comparisons - for some reason this lo-fi unvarnished version is the only one that would get past having a complete copyright block preventing anyone from viewing it. DVD opens the video and rotates every 12 seconds.

      As we continue to wait... and wait... and wait for The Abyss to arrive on 4K or even just a proper Blu-ray - this HD stream from Amazon Prime will just have to hold us over. And what's here ain't bad at all! Of course, in order to view this film, you need to have an Amazon Prime account.

      Burbank, CA – August 24, 2021 – Warner Bros., STUDIOCANAL, and American Zoetrope today announce the forthcoming 4K restoration of the 1983 American coming-of-age drama, THE OUTSIDERS THE COMPLETE NOVEL, from Academy Award®-winning visionary director Francis Ford Coppola. Created to give fans more of the action that took place in S.E. Hinton’s celebrated book, Coppola’s latest, definitive version includes new music, as well as several scenes cut from the theatrical version which were reconstructed from original camera negatives. Warner Bros. will release THE OUTSIDERS THE COMPLETE NOVEL theatrically in the US and Canada beginning on September 26th with tickets going on sale this week.  Details are available at Fandango.com. Warner Bros. will also make both it and the original version available in a 4K UHD Collector’s Edition and on digital platforms starting November 9th. Additionally, THE OUTSIDERS THE COMPLETE NOVEL will be available on HBO Max beginning on November 16th and will also air this fall on Turner Classic Movies (TCM). 

       

      Said Coppola, ‘“The Outsiders The Complete Novel’ came about after meeting students over the years who repeatedly asked me why certain scenes from S.E. Hinton’s wonderful book were missing from the theatrical version. These questions reminded about my inspiration for the film—in 1980, a contingent of 12- to 14-year-old students wrote and asked me to make it. I listened to those young fans back then, and I continue to listen to young people now and believe in their opinions, so this complete film version of the novel is for them.”

       

      STUDIOCANAL is handling the release internationally and will release THE OUTSIDERS THE COMPLETE NOVEL theatrically in the UK, and will make both it and the original version available in a 4K UHD Collector’s Edition and on Blu-Ray, DVD and digital platforms starting November 8th.

       

      Based on the 1967 best-selling young-adult novel by S. E. Hinton, THE OUTSIDERS is considered the first “Brat Pack” movie, as it stars then-unknown young actors in many of their first break-through roles, including C. Thomas Howell (E.T. the Extra-Terrestrial), Rob Lowe (“The West Wing,” Parks and Recreation”), Emilio Estevez (St. Elmo's Fire, The Breakfast Club, Young Guns), Matt Dillon (Crash, There's Something About Mary), Tom Cruise (Top Gun, Mission Impossible series, Jerry Maguire), Patrick Swayze (Dirty Dancing, Point Break, Ghost), Ralph Macchio (The Karate Kid, Cobra Kai), and Diane Lane (Unfaithful, Under the Tuscan Sun), who went on to superstar-caliber careers.

       

      THE OUTSIDERS takes place in '60s Oklahoma, centering on two rival teen gangs: The “Greasers,” a class term that refers to the young men on the East Side, the poor side of town, and the “Socs,” short for Socials, who are the “West-side rich kids.” Ponyboy (C. Thomas Howell), a tender-hearted and kind teenager’s life is changed forever one night when a scuffle with his friend Johnny (Ralph Macchio) inadvertently leads to the death of a rival gang member, and the boys are forced to go into hiding to avoid arrest. Soon Ponyboy and Johnny, along with Dallas (Matt Dillon) and their other Greaser buddies, must contend with the consequences of their violent lives. While some Greasers try to achieve redemption, others meet tragic ends.

       

      Inspired by Jo Ellen Misakian, a librarian who had sent Coppola a letter signed by over 300 students explaining that the book was cult reading among local teens, Coppola captures adolescent teen emotions and the growing realization of life’s cruelties and a yearning for a life not attainable.

       

      For ‘The Outsiders The Complete Novel’ as well as the original theatrical version, we wanted to create and maintain the highest level of visual quality possible for these restorations,” commented James Mockoski, Film Archivist and Restoration Supervisor at American Zoetrope. “We took the unusual path of locating all the various elements that went into creating the film's most elaborate visual effects sequences and re-scanned them. Luckily, Mr. Coppola is an archivist at heart and he kept every piece of film he shot, so we were able to unify scenes from the film using the original camera negative as much as possibleIt was important to Mr. Coppola to give this release its best quality presentation, and no one has ever seen this film looking as beautiful and pristine as it does now.”
